Helix Swarm管理者ガイド (2020.1)

グループ構成

デフォルト設定の場合、すべてのユーザがSwarm[グループ]メニュー項目を使用して、ユーザグループのリストを表示することができます。 ユーザは、グループのメンバーのみでなく、そのユーザのアクティビティも表示することができます。

ヒント

構成情報を変更しても、構成キャッシュを再ロードしない限り、その構成情報がSwarmで使用されることはありません。構成キャッシュを再ロードすると、変更した構成情報がSwarmで強制的に使用されます。 Swarm構成キャッシュを再ロードするには、admin ユーザまたはsuper ユーザでなくてはなりません。 [ユーザID]ドロップダウンメニューに移動して[システム情報]を選択し、[キャッシュ情報]タブをクリックしてから[構成の再ロード]ボタンをクリックします。

管理者は、SWARM_ROOT/data/config.phpファイル内のgroups構成ブロックで、[グループ]メニュー項目の表示を設定することができます。以下に例を示します。

<?php
// this block should be a peer of 'p4'
'groups' => array(
'super_only' => true, // ['true'|'false'] default value is 'false'
),

super_onlyオプションをtrueに設定すると、管理者以外のユーザに対して[グループ]タブが非表示になります。

ヒント

[グループ]メニュー項目の表示をより詳細に制御する必要がある場合は、menu_helpers構成ブロック内にgroupsブロックを追加します。 これにより、認証済みユーザ、admin権限を持つユーザ、またはsuper権限を持つユーザに対してのみ、[グループ]メニュー項目を表示することができます。 [グループ]メニュー項目の表示を制御するには、menu_helper構成ブロック内で定義されているグループに対して、super_only設定とrole設定を組み合わせて制御することに注意する必要があります。 Swarmは、これらの設定のうち最も制限の厳しい設定を使用して、[グループ]メニュー項目の表示を制御します。